Kid Angles

1500 E Hillside Drive
Bloomington, IN 47401
Kid Angles is a state-licensed facility that upholds the highest standares of operation, health and staffing.
Each staff member undergoes background checks, drug testing and CPR/First id training.
We believe that learning can be fun and incorporate play as part of our learning experiences.

Quick Facts (2025-26)

  • School Type: Early Childhood / Day Care
  • Grades: Nursery/Preschool
  • Enrollment: 49 students
  • Average class size: 10 students
  • Application Deadline: None / Rolling
  • Source: National Center for Education Statistics (NCES)
